What Are Service Robots?

Service robots encompass a variety of robots used across various industries, excluding robots used for traditional industrial applications like assembly, palletizing, and welding. Service robots typically handle tedious, dirty, and sometimes risky tasks that require exceptional precision.

Some common types of service robots include:

  • Industrial service robots

  • Domestic robots

  • Medical robots

  • Delivery robots

  • Agricultural robots

  • Logistics robots

  • Customer service robots

Applications of Service Robots Across Different Industries

Businesses across various industries use service robots. Service robots generally supplement human employees in their daily tasks, allowing them to focus on the core aspects of their work.

Here are various industries that employ service robotics and their common applications:

Healthcare

Hospitals often use service robots for cleaning and disinfection to enhance patient and healthcare workers’ safety. Commonly known as sterilization or disinfection robots, these service robots come in two variants: solution-based and ultraviolet (UV) sterilization robots. The former uses spray disinfectant solutions to sterilize surfaces, while the latter uses UV light.

For instance, LightStrike6 — a UV sterilization robot developed by Xenex Disinfection Services — was used in hospitals to eradicate SARS-CoV-2, the COVID-19-causing virus, during the pandemic.

Besides cleaning and disinfecting surfaces, hospitals use service robots to aid in patient care tasks like dispensing medicine, lifting and transporting patients, and even providing emotional support. 

For example, in 2021, Hanson Robotics launched a nursing robot that can provide patients with companionship, measure responsiveness, and even detect temperature changes.

Retail

Many retailers use service robots to enhance shoppers’ in-store experiences. For example, in 2017, home improvement retailer Lowe’s launched the Lowebot, a sophisticated service robot that helps customers easily find products in their stores.

Besides improving the customer experience, retailers use service robots to streamline their operations, deploying them for tasks like product retrieval, cleaning, and inventory management. For instance, in 2016, Target tested a robot worker called Tally to track store inventory.

Logistics

The global e-commerce market was valued at $18.98 trillion in 2022 and is forecasted to reach $47.73 trillion by 2030. As e-commerce sales continue to spike, more logistics businesses are using logistics service robots to cope with rising consumer demand for goods and labor shortages.

For instance, e-commerce giant Amazon uses service robots to automate order fulfillment across its warehouses. Amazon also uses service robots to deliver packages to consumers and businesses.

As a result, it’s no wonder the logistics robot market is one of the fastest-growing service robot segments. As of 2021, the global logistics robots market was valued at $7.11 billion and is expected to reach $21.01 billion by 2029, representing a compound annual growth rate (CAGR) of 16.7% during the forecast period.

Hospitality

In the hospitality sector, service robots are used to streamline operations and improve customer experiences. Hotels, for instance, use service robots to welcome guests, check them in, and deliver their luggage to rooms. For instance, Connie, Hilton’s robot concierge, answers guests’ inquiries, helping them to navigate the hotel.

Besides hotels, restaurants leverage service robots to take orders, deliver food, and prepare simple dishes. Large chain restaurants like Wendy’s, White Castle, and McDonald’s employ robot chatbots to take orders at drive-through restaurants.

Education

In the education sector, service robots help enhance learning by teaching and guiding students and providing personalized lessons tailored to specific needs. Educational institutions also use them for administrative tasks like record-keeping, scheduling meetings, and answering queries.

Research institutions also leverage robots to conduct scientific research and experiments. For instance, researchers use Nao, a smart humanoid service robot, as a research assistant to teach programming and perform research into human-robot interactions.

Agriculture

Many industries use service robots indoors or within relatively well-controlled environments. In contrast, service robots in the agricultural sector work outdoors, often in harsh conditions.

Commonly known as agricultural robots, service robots in the agriculture sector help with tasks like planting, harvesting, and weeding. Farmers also use them for aerial imaging to track crop growth, detect diseases, and predict yields.

For instance, Vegebot, an agricultural robot developed by researchers at the University of Cambridge, uses machine learning to help farmers harvest lettuce.

Benefits of Service Robots

Service robots offer many benefits for businesses looking to streamline their operations and enhance customer experiences. Here are some of the top perks of service robots:

Increased Safety

Workplace safety is a top priority for many workers. In fact, 97% of employees consider their physical safety extremely important. Service robots can protect workers from potential hazards in high-risk workplaces.

For instance, cleaning and disinfecting robots in hospitals clean and sterilize surfaces, protecting health workers from contracting infectious diseases due to exposure to pathogens.

Enhanced Productivity

Service robots can work tirelessly, round-the-clock. Unlike humans, they don’t require breaks. As a result, they can boost productivity and allow human employees to work on higher-level tasks rather than repetitive, mundane tasks. For instance, delivery service robots can transport items 24/7 without changing shifts or taking breaks like humans.

Cost-Savings

Service robots cost thousands of dollars. While the initial investment in them may be high, service robots can enhance productivity and efficiency, potentially offsetting initial investment expenses in the long term.

Greater Precision

Service robots perform tasks with remarkable accuracy and thoroughness compared to human workers. For example, agricultural robots can harvest vegetables with exceptional precision without bruising them. This results in improved efficiency and product quality.

Is a Service Robot Suitable for A Business?

Service robots offer various benefits. However, there are certain factors to consider before employing them. Here are some issues that may make getting service robots a worthwhile investment:

Labor Shortages

Many companies globally are struggling to fill job vacancies, particularly those in the manufacturing, logistics, and healthcare sectors. For instance, in the United States, three out of five employers can’t find suitable employees for vacancies.

Companies struggling to recruit talent for vacancies might want to employ service robots. For instance, hotels might benefit from deploying service robots if they can’t find suitable talent for a concierge role. 

Increased Consumer Demand

As businesses scale, they often face a spike in product demand. Businesses struggling to fulfill orders due to increased consumer demand might want to integrate service robots into their operations.

For instance, e-commerce businesses might want to employ service robots in their warehouses to streamline order fulfillment and keep up with larger order volumes.

Reduced Employee Productivity

Many jobs involve repetitive, mundane tasks that can be easily automated. Employees working in the logistics industry often perform repetitive tasks like retrieving products, sorting them, and tracking inventory. Service robots can handle these tasks, allowing human employees to focus on other core aspects of their work.

Running a business that often requires employees to perform repetitive and dull tasks, service robots might greatly benefit the business.
